SYM OEseRIPTiON DATE APPROVED i i 05-15560-5 ABSTRACT AND LIST OF KEY WORDS This document presents the postflight trajectory for the Apollo/ Saturn V AS-505 flight. Included is an analysis of the orbital and powered flight trajectories of the launch vehicle, the free flight trajectories of the expended S-IC and S-II stages, and the slingshot trajectory of the S-IVB/IU. Trajectory dependent parameters are provided in earth-fixed launch site, launch vehicle navigation, and geographic polar coordinate systems. The time history of the trajectory parameters for the launch vehicle is presented from guidance reference release to CSM separation. Tables of engine cutOff, stage separation, parking orbit in sertion, and translunar injection conditions are included in this document. The heliocentric parameters of the S-IVB/IU are given. Figures of such parameters as altitude, surface and cross ranges, and magnitudes of total velocity and accel eration as a function of range time for the powered flight trajectories are presented.
